Comprehending Sweden's Driving License System

Sweden concerns driving licenses through the Transport Agency (Transportstyrelsen), which manages all matters connected to chauffeur certification, lorry registration, and road safety regulations. The Swedish driving license is acknowledged throughout the European Union and the European Economic Area, making it valuable for citizens who plan to take a trip or relocate within these areas.

The most typical license classification in Sweden is the B license, which allows holders to drive passenger cars weighing up to 3,500 kilograms. This license covers the majority of personal cars and is what many individuals seek when discovering to drive. Extra categories exist for motorbikes, trucks, and buses, each with their own particular requirements and screening treatments.

Eligibility Requirements for Swedish Driving Licenses

Before beginning the application procedure, candidates need to satisfy several essential requirements established by the Transport Agency. Most importantly, applicants should be at least 16 years of age for a motorbike license and 18 years of age for a basic B license. Additionally, candidates need to have lived in Sweden for a minimum of 185 days before receiving a Swedish license, though this requirement does not use to Swedish people from birth.

Medical fitness constitutes another important requirement. All applicants must go through a medical assessment conducted by a licensed doctor to ensure they meet the minimum health requirements for driving. This evaluation examines vision, cardiovascular health, neurological conditions, and any other aspects that might hinder driving ability. Candidates with specific medical conditions may face constraints or additional evaluations before receiving certification.

The Practical Driving Test

The final step in the procedure is the useful driving test, which assesses a prospect's ability to operate a car safely in real traffic conditions. An examiner from the Transport Agency accompanies the candidate during a 30-45 minute drive, evaluating parking abilities, lane altering, interaction with other road users, and overall vehicle control. The test also includes a safety assessment part where prospects must recognize and resolve potential lorry problems. Passing this test shows that the candidate can drive individually and responsibly.

Often Asked Questions

Can I use my existing foreign driving license in Sweden?

Residents of EU/EEA nations can typically utilize their valid driving license in Sweden for the period of their residence, normally up to one year after establishing residency. After this duration, the license must be exchanged for a Swedish equivalent. Licenses from nations outside the EU/EEA are usually legitimate for driving in Sweden for up to one year, after which holders should acquire a Swedish license. Some countries have exchange arrangements with Sweden that enable conversion without extra screening, while others require candidates to finish the full Swedish licensing procedure.

What occurs if I fail the driving test several times?

While there is no limitation on the variety of efforts at the practical driving test, prospects who stop working several times should complete additional training before each subsequent effort. Many driving schools need students who have actually stopped working two times or more to go through refresher lessons addressing their specific weak points. This requirement exists because each test failure normally exposes specific skill gaps that require focused attention before another attempt.

What documents do I require to offer when applying?

Applicants should supply valid recognition (passport or national ID card), evidence of Swedish residence (population register certificate), finished application, medical certificate validating physical fitness to drive, and photographs fulfilling main requirements. Those exchanging foreign licenses need to furthermore offer the original license and main translation if the license is not in Swedish or an extensively acknowledged language.
